Output 6fa77b308447a7de77272ae8aa1fbe6586f37dc3e3c8cfcbfd4ece2eb0850290:0

value
11713394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d5f409baef63b4ff440e57d6e45cbafd7db638 OP_EQUAL
address
39RazPfURnrXTxjkE4vG2QikzsFNuSXCuX
transaction
6fa77b308447a7de77272ae8aa1fbe6586f37dc3e3c8cfcbfd4ece2eb0850290
confirmations
356674
spent
true